Marriage of Susan Morgan and William Baer at Chariton First Presbyterian

The July 2 ceremony at Chariton united Susan Morgan and William Baer with a daisy and babies breath themed altar. Rev. Frederick Mansfield officiated as the couple bowed to vows, then sang Wedding Prayer. A fellowship reception followed, with guests and family in attendance, future home in Chariton.

Couples to Hold Anniversary Dance in Malvern

An anniversary dance for Mr and Mrs Robert Hopp and Mr and Mrs Donnie Schroeder is set for Friday August 26 at 8 30 p m at the Malvern Community Building with Ernie Kucera s Polka Band providing music No invitations will be sent and gifts are declined. DITTMAN FAMILY REUNION HELD Sunday at Park. Hosts were Mr and Mrs Wm Kahl for 49 descendants of Fred and Martha Dittman in attendance with families from Emerson Nebraska Nebraska City and Allen.

Genealogical Society Meets August 25 in Glenwood

Mills County Genealogical Society will meet at the Mills County Historical Building in Glenwood at 7 40 p m on August 25. The free membership prize at the county fair went to Ms Marjorie Swett of Malvern who stopped by the genealogy booth to register.

Clarence Boos Will Be Honored Open House in Hastings

An open house is planned for friends and relatives of Mr and Mrs Clarence Boos at 7:30 PM Thursday at the United Methodist church in Hastings. They ran a Hastings grocery for several years and his father Reverend Clair Boos formerly pastored the church. Come join them for an evening of visiting.

Legion Meeting At Liberty Memorial Draws Four

Legion Post 520 held an August 12 meeting at the Liberty Memorial Building with four attendees John Phelps Peggy Phelps C L Bud Hertz Charles Ellison and Sylvia Klonis. A September meeting is planned after Heritage Days with date to be announced.
